President Lee Jae-myung on the 26th praised the police for their focused crackdown on "Daepo cars" (vehicles illegally registered under someone else's name and driven by a different person), saying it was "a job very well done."

While on a tour of the United States and South America, President Lee posted on his X account (formerly Twitter) on this day, linking to media reports that the National Office of Investigation of the National Police Agency had conducted a focused investigation into Daepo cars in the first half of the year, detecting 1,928 such vehicles and arresting and referring 380 related individuals to prosecutors.



President Lee stated, "Daepo cars have long been exploited for crimes yet were effectively neglected, so it is a very good thing that the National Office of Investigation cracked down on these vehicles in earnest." He went on to say, "Thank you and I support your efforts." He further requested, "Please also crack down swiftly and thoroughly on other crimes that threaten people's livelihoods to ease the worries of the public."
